No Alcohol & Coffee – Venice is calling! #FitnessTuesday

October 6, 2015 By fitness4mamas 3 Comments

coffee nespresso

In less than 3 weeks I will be on a plane to Venice, and have to be honest the nerves are starting to kick in. Have I trained enough? What to expect on the actual day? One of the things that always worry me is the weather, which is something that you cannot influence and I have to believe it will not be raining. I know it’s the end of October, so I do not expect it to be very hot, but a nice warm day would be just perfect, so fingers crossed.

Yesterday I had a long run planned, but it was raining loads, and I did not think I should do it. I will have to swap for one day this week, my last longish run, and then just a few short ones, my spinning classes and taking it easy, need to start saving the energy for the big race.

I ran 2 marathons so far, and the nerves & adrenalin on the actual race day are something I will never forget. This time it will be also a bit different as it will be just me, in a foreign country, but I am not scared. I am very excited to be part of the crowd! I speak a few foreign languages, unfortunately not Italian, but guess I will be fine, and believe there will be a few English people too, maybe even Czech, who knows!

I have also decided to completely cut out alcohol & coffee for the whole of October. This is not only part of my marathon preparation but also due to me taking part in Seven Seas Perfect7 challenge.

I can tell you now, this will not be easy as I love my wine and coffee!
